Annapolis (pronunciation ; /əˈnæpəlɪs/) is the capital of the U.S. state of Maryland, as well as the county seat of Anne Arundel County. Situated on the Chesapeake Bay at the mouth of the Severn River, 25 miles (40 km) south of Baltimore and about 30 miles (50 km) east of Washington, D.C., Annapolis is part of the Baltimore–Washington metropolitan area. Its population was measured at 38,394 by the 2010 census.

Contents Prior to the start of winter season temperature levels, you require to be sure your furnace will work properly. Here are some signs that you might require a heater repair. A furnace that is adequately preserved is most likely to last fifteen to twenty years. However, a furnace that is older than that will not be as effective.
Pay attention to any weird sounds, smells, or poor efficiency. If your heating system is behaving abnormally, employ an expert to check it out. An expert HEATING AND COOLING professional can let you know if you require to change or repair your heating unit. A furnace that does not provide proper heat throughout the house might be signaling that it is not going to last much longer.
A number of issues can trigger a heating system to put out cold air instead of warm air. A common cause of this issue is a blower fan that no longer works properly. If the motor on the blower fan is not working, your heating system will not be able to blow warm air into your home.

If the heater is not warming your house at all, there might be a problem with the heat exchanger or the pilot burner. You should employ a professional to deal with this issue immediately. Another indication that your heater might require a repair is that your heating expenses have gone up a lot.
However, when a furnace is not energy effective, it can not heat up the home as effectively as it did in the past. It will need to run for a longer time and will, for that reason, utilize more energy. Your heating expense will increase, and your wallet will suffer. Heaters need a repair service at particular times in their life-spans.
Paying for a lot of repair work can injure your savings account. Heating systems often have a great deal of issues in the final 2 years of their lifespan. When you observe you are requiring furnace repair work often, it is an indication that you need to conserve for a replacement heater. If your furnace runs on natural gas, check to see that the pilot burner is not yellow but blue.
It can even indicate that there is carbon monoxide gas leading from the unit. Carbon monoxide is a fatal gas without any odor or color and is known as the “quiet killer.” Other indications that your furnace might not be burning fuel effectively are excess wetness, rust, and an odor of rotten eggs.
Contact an A/C expert to look after the circumstance. If your heating unit is defective, it can make your heater put out an odor like burning rubber or hot metal. The burning smell may imply that part of the furnace is getting too hot and overheating. A heating system that overheats can start a fire.

Be sure you keep watch on the heater while you are waiting for the technician to arrive.
